Wednesday, Thursday, Friday, Saturday, Sunday: 10:00 AM - 04:00 PMEnd pointThis activity ends back at the meeting point.WHAT TO EXPECTLocated just a 15-minute drive from Rotorua, the Buried Village of Te Wairoa features an interactive museum, scenic walking trails and a look at the devastating effects of one of New Zealands greatest natural disasters: the Mt Tarawera volcanic eruption of 1886, which wiped out a natural landmark known as the Pink and White Terraces and killed many people.
Expect to spend at least 1.5 hours for the entire experience, including audio guides, living history tours and talks by costumed guides scheduled throughout the day. Gain firsthand insight into the chaos of the night that Mt Tarawera erupted and destroyed Te Wairoa, a village inhabited by Maori and missionaries. Children can search for clues using a special guide map of the excavated sites.
On the Waterfall Trail, learn about the geothermal features of the landscape, including Lake Tarawera, and stand in the spray of Wairere Falls as it plunges 98 feet (30 meters) to the valley below.
Youll find a range of goods at the gift shop and scones with tea or coffee at Vi's Teahouse.1: Buried Village of Te WairoaThe Buried Village of Te Wairoa, just a 15-minute drive from Rotorua city, offers a firsthand look at one of New Zealands greatest natural disasters. Learn about the devastating effects when Mt. Tarawera erupted in 1886, which buried Te Wairoa and ended more than 150 lives. Now, well over a century later, the excavated village provides a unique opportunity to see how the area's Maori inhabitants and early settlers lived.

Your pilot takes off over the crater lakes of the Northern Lakes district before treating you to expansive aerial views over the lunar-like landscape of the volcano, which includes a 5-mile-long (8-kilometer) rift.
Soaring over Lake Tarawera, the helicopter circles the volcanic terrain, including a vast crater system formed by the 1886 eruption, which covered the village of Te Wairoa and took 153 lives. Learn about the destruction of the Pink and White Terraceswaterfall pools that drew 19th-century tourists to the shores of Lake Rotomahana.

The National Kiwi Hatchery is the national leader in kiwi husbandry, egg incubation systems, hatching techniques and kiwi chick rearing. When you join one of our experiences, you'll get to see kiwi eggs being incubated, the hatching process and newly hatched kiwi chicks.
Hatching season is September and March and the highest chance for you to see kiwi eggs and chicks. Outside of these months you will have chance to observe our resident adult kiwi foraging in our Nocturnal House.
